Course Description
This course introduces chiropractic physicians to a modern brain-body framework for understanding mental health through neuroscience, functional neurology, chiropractic medicine, neurotechnology, lifestyle physiology, and rehabilitative care. Attendees will explore how nervous system regulation, sensory integration, autonomic balance, metabolism, sleep, movement, and mindset influence mental health outcomes and patient resilience. Practical clinical applications and emerging technologies will be discussed within ethical, collaborative healthcare models.
Learning Objectives
- Describe the relationship between nervous system regulation, neuroplasticity, and mental health outcomes.
- Explain functional neurology principles related to anxiety, OCD, ADHD, stress, dizziness, sleep dysfunction, and cognitive fatigue.
- Discuss the role of spinal biomechanics, vestibular input, proprioception, and sensory integration in brain regulation.
- Identify indicators of autonomic nervous system dysregulation and stress physiology.
- Recognize the influence of sleep, metabolism, inflammation, and lifestyle factors on brain health.
- Describe emerging neurotechnology applications including neurofeedback, eye-tracking, vestibular rehabilitation technologies, balance assessment systems, and HRV monitoring.
- Discuss mindset coaching, patient communication, and collaborative care strategies that support patient engagement and resilience.
